Beatitude House
Housing & Shelter in Youngstown, Ohio. Serves: Women and children, homeless and formerly homeless, low income; mental health; families; low-income; domestic violence. Transitional Housing Our transitional housing program, A House of Blessing, provides a family with a fully-furnished apartment while mothers work on their educational goals and employment.
